I need to find the points of inflection and discuss the concavity of the graph of the function below. I am stuck is there anyone that can help me please? f(x)=2x^3-3x^2-12x+5
Still Need Help?
Join the QuestionCove community and study together with friends!
f'(x)=6x^2-6x-12
f"(x)=12x-6 and when i solve for x when set equal to 0 I get x=1/2
but I'm having trouble with coming up with my intervals
I thought that you used your values for x to make your intervals but since i don't have multiple values for x then can i just make up some and choose test values within those limits?
